As Netflix continues to grow and expand, we are looking for a talented team member to become an integral part of the Tax Transformation team. We are seeking an experienced Indirect Tax Systems expert to join our team in either Los Angeles or Los Gatos. In this role, you will be responsible for implementing and maintaining a global indirect tax engine to support our global indirect tax teams and product business lines. You will also be responsible for the buildout of automated review procedures for tax rate and rule changes, as well as a comprehensive tax reporting module for indirect compliance and month end close processes.

Role location can be Los Gatos, CA or Hollywood, CA.

Responsibilities

  • Lead the implementation of a global indirect tax engine and act as the system administrator post-deployment. Duties include user management, maintaining process documentation, managing custom configurations within the system, logging and investigating issues, and serving as the primary contact for data exports and reporting.
  • Drive projects to optimize global indirect tax processes, such as data collection, reconciliations, compliance, reporting, and system controls.
  • Monitor and implement best practices for tax calculations within the engine and stay current with the latest tax technology and system trends in the global indirect tax space.
  • Collaborate with global tax leads and engineering stakeholders to ensure proper collection and delivery of tax requirements for global indirect tax calculations, reporting, reconciliations, and tax assurance.
  • Identify and address the data needs and challenges of the global indirect tax team, working to centralize and standardize data requirements for compliance and reporting.
  • Prepare business user guides and reference materials for the indirect engine to be leveraged by the global indirect tax team and other business stakeholders.
  • Manage tax rate and rule changes within the tax engine in collaboration with local tax teams.
  • Onboard future lines of business to the global indirect tax engine and work with cross-functional stakeholders to ensure both tax and business requirements are met.
  • Collaborate with FinTech and regional tax teams to understand e-invoicing and live reporting requirements and manage necessary system implementations.

Qualifications

  • Minimum 7 years of experience in public accounting and/or corporate tax departments.
  • Hands-on experience implementing Global Indirect Tax systems working with third-party engines (e.g. Vertex or Thomson Reuters Sabrix preferred) and ERP systems.
  • Strong tax technical skills in US sales and use tax, global VAT/GST, and global e-invoicing and live reporting requirements.
  • Proven experience working with global indirect tax advisory and compliance teams.
  • Strong with data management and visualization.
  • Solid understanding of indirect tax accounting principles.
  • Strong project management and communication skills.
  • Strong in stakeholder management and cross-functional alignment.
